    Role Overview:

    The Certified Nursing Assistant-Direct Support Professionals at Enchanted Hearts Home Care LLC plays a vital role in improving the quality of life for individuals who need assistance or support. As to uphold in providing the utmost medical essential support and companionship, allowing to maintain their independence and dignity. This position involves providing compassionate support to individuals (including elderly, people with disabilities, or those recovering from injury) with their activities in their daily living and support overall well-being.

    Responsibilities:

    Personalized Care Planning & Implementation: Actively participate in helping and following personalized plans (Individualized Support Plans), tracking progress, and adjusting to help clients reach their goals.

    Behavioral Guidance & Positive Support: Implement positive methods to guide behavior, handle crisis, and create a safe & understanding environment.

    Personal Care: Provide comprehensive personal care services, including b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ting, ensuring the comfort and hygiene of clients.

    Meal Preparation and Nutrition: Prepare nutritious meals, assist with feeding, and ensure adherence to dietary requirements.

    Household Management: Perform light housekeeping duties to maintain a clean, safe, and organized living environment.

    Social and Life Skills Support: Facilitate social interaction, provide guidance on vocational skills, and assist with developing essential life skills.

    Activities of Daily Living (ADLs): Provide comprehensive support with ADLs, including mobility assistance, transfers, and lifting, ensuring client safety and independence.

    Transportation and Appointments: Assist clients with transportation to medical appointments, social activities, and errands, ensuring timely and safe travel.

    Medical Assistance: Administer medication reminders, monitor vital signs, and assist with basic medical tasks as directed by the client's care plan.

    Documentation and Reporting: Maintain accurate and detailed records of client care and progress, ensuring comp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ements.

    Requirements / Qualifications:

    Willingness to be trained as a Direct Support Professional (DSP)

    Education: Possess of a High School Diploma or GED or equivalent

    Experience: Has experience as a Certified Nursing Assistant is highly preferred

    Certifications: Has formal training and completed the CNA Licensure and has CPR Certification

    Compassion, Patient, and Empathy: Has the genuinely desire to help others and a compassionate approach to caregiving especially for people with developmental disability

    Reliability and Punctuality: Has a strong work ethic and ability to maintain a consistent schedule and dependable with clients

    Reliable Transportation: Must hold a valid driving license. Ideally, candidates should have their own vehicle with insurance, though a company car is available for work-related errands and client visits.
